From 60cabacd46d9fbf459e4c8f3e8b4e12503b491a8 Mon Sep 17 00:00:00 2001 From: Linnea Gräf Date: Sat, 6 Sep 2025 21:09:50 +0200 Subject: ci: set content permissions on release upload --- .github/workflows/build.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 5989a02..0cd0b64 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-72,6 +72,8 @@ jobs: name: Prepare a release runs-on: ubuntu-22.04 needs: build + permissions: + contents: write if: ${{ 'push' == github.event_name && startsWith(github.ref, 'refs/tags/') }} steps: - uses: actions/checkout@v4 @@ -92,4 +94,4 @@ jobs: env: GH_TOKEN: ${{ github.token }} run: | - gh release create -t "Firmament ${GITHUB_REF#refs/tags/}" "${GITHUB_REF#refs/tags/}" -F "changelog.md" "*.jar" + gh release create --draft -t "Firmament ${GITHUB_REF#refs/tags/}" "${GITHUB_REF#refs/tags/}" -F "changelog.md" "*.jar" -- cgit